Output 74c93f580fdf671722dc84548a3bd301d3e5cc9531c565e0ac981fd68ac04f30:1

value
1010663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67aecb7cf66ca442d7e580231301f3658fc9b3f2 OP_EQUALVERIFY OP_CHECKSIG
address
1ATDzij4eN9e8cbbvk4Wbf9okvLJP8mL75
transaction
74c93f580fdf671722dc84548a3bd301d3e5cc9531c565e0ac981fd68ac04f30
spent
true